Are NA meetings in Adrian, Missouri free?

NA meetings in Adrian, Missouri are free to attend. Meetings are self-supporting through voluntary contributions from members, but no one is expected to donate, especially newcomers. NA receives no outside funding.

What happens if I relapse and come back to a Adrian, Missouri meeting?

Come back to meetings. Many recovering addicts have experienced relapse, and the fellowship in Adrian, Missouri welcomes anyone who returns with a desire to stay clean. You will not be judged or shamed for coming back.

Can I attend NA in Adrian, Missouri while seeing a therapist or counselor?

Absolutely. The fellowship in Adrian, Missouri complements professional care rather than replacing it. People across the Bates area often combine NA meetings with therapy, treatment, or medical care.
